With the use of our licensed patented Molecular Bonding System (MBS) we are able to chemically change heavy metals such as chromium, cadmium, mercury, arsenic and lead from contaminated soil into non-hazardous forms.(in situ) Currently these chemicals are leaching into the water tables below the surface of the land and thus contaminating the water systems. MBS is comprised of carbonates, sulphides and phosphates which oxidize the heavy metals and turn them into non-leachable sulphides. After we have chemically changed the hazardous chemicals from the soil it is placed back in its original location and the land becomes safe to use for development purposes, thus omitting the large cost of removing and trucking out the contaminated soils.
